Transaction 50431c0173e7d3963171984e5cfba39b6ff43931a9127ebe1d34c2c676a8965b

1 Input
2 Outputs
  • 50431c0173e7d3963171984e5cfba39b6ff43931a9127ebe1d34c2c676a8965b:0
  • value  266730
    address  3E3pLGL9dUa74UXmEQNRumnutWgLakJEYM
  • 50431c0173e7d3963171984e5cfba39b6ff43931a9127ebe1d34c2c676a8965b:1
  • value  2657498
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p